Abstract
The invention discloses a kind of fruit young fruit bagging devices, its structure includes fuselage, head, fuselage is equipped with handle, pack box, head is equipped with set sack, tabletting, withhold device, the beneficial effects of the present invention are: squeezer can be pushed by cover board, so that the press strip on buckle suppresses retaining ring, so that retaining ring forms zigzag annular shape discount, sack is driven to be buckled on the branch on apple, apple is entangled, because of the laciniation that press strip is formed, sack is entangled firm on apple, so that sack will not be fallen easily, simultaneously when carrying out sack disassembly, sack can be disassembled by gently pullling sack, it can be carried out by tool when pullling, sack will not be so made so that apple is fallen off in disassembly, it will not cause to be difficult to dismantle, it can be improved unpacking while guaranteeing the safety and appearance of apple Working efficiency.
Description
Technical field
The present invention relates to agriculture field, specifically a kind of fruit young fruit bagging device.
Background technique
The price of fruit increasingly goes up, one reason for this is that because the plantation and nursing of fruit tree are increasingly fine and complicated,
Apple is as common fruit, in order to guarantee that apple is not stained with pesticide in laxative, do not pecked by birds after maturation it is bad, in sunlight
Since blocking for leaf causes apple surface uneven color under irradiation, appearance is influenced, to need to be covered outside apple
Bag.
For the problem that current fruit young fruit bagging device, opposite scheme has been formulated for existing below:
Existing bagging device is sealed by staple, although such sealing mode is easy bookbinding, while bagging jail
Gu but will be pretty troublesome when carrying out unpacking, apple tree is largely planted, not only numb if carrying out unpacking one by one
It is tired, inefficiency, while also because to dismantle the sack of eminence to which there are security risks.

Beneficial effect
When a kind of fruit young fruit bagging device of the present invention is worked:
Device is withheld by being equipped with one kind, for the device of withholding equipped with gland, squeezer, bottom plate, escape groove, the gland is equipped with pressure
Bar, cover board push, and move so that squeezer be pushed to carry out relative direction on bottom plate, squeezer squeeze buckle in the process of moving
Ring, so that retaining ring is held on branch;
By being equipped with a kind of cover board, the gland is equipped with compression bar, and when cover board pushes, the compression bar of cover board two sides of the bottom is simultaneously
It pushes, is moved to squeeze squeezer;
By being equipped with a kind of squeezer, the squeezer is equipped with projection, spring, buckle, when the projection on squeezer is squeezed by compression bar
Pressure, so that projection be pushed to be moved on bottom plate, it is mobile that projection carries out relative direction, to squeeze spring, push buckle into
Row movement;
By being equipped with a kind of bottom plate, the bottom plate is equipped with retaining ring conveying trough, buckle sliding slot, retaining ring, when projection carries out mobile
It waits, is driven by the buckle sliding slot on bottom plate, so that buckle squeezes retaining ring, so that the press strip of buckle inner wall squeezes retaining ring,
Tooth form groove is formed on retaining ring, because retaining ring is metallic sheet-like formation, convenient for squeezing, but not carries out elastic recovery, therefore
Retaining ring indention drives sack to be stuck on branch.
Compared with prior art, the beneficial effects of the present invention are: squeezer can be pushed by cover board, so that buckle
On press strip suppress retaining ring so that retaining ring formed zigzag annular shape discount, drive sack be buckled on the branch on apple, by apple
Fruit is entangled, because the laciniation that press strip is formed, enables sack to entangle firm on apple, so that sack will not fall easily
It falls, while when carrying out sack disassembly, sack can be disassembled by gently pullling sack, it can be with when pullling
It is carried out by tool, will not so make sack so that apple is fallen off in disassembly, will not cause to be difficult to dismantle, guaranteeing apple
Safety and appearance while can be improved the working efficiency of unpacking.
